Hydrologists in Pennsylvania earn a median salary of $91,730 per year ($7,644/month). This is 6.2% below the national average of $97,815. Pennsylvania ranks #21 out of 34 states for Hydrologists pay. Approximately 160 people work in this occupation across Pennsylvania. Salaries decreased by 2.7% compared to 2024.

About This Job: Hydrologists

Research the distribution, circulation, and physical properties of underground and surface waters; and study the form and intensity of precipitation and its rate of infiltration into the soil, movement through the earth, and return to the ocean and atmosphere.

Salary Range: Hydrologists in Pennsylvania

Salaries for Hydrologists in Pennsylvania range from $45,300 at the 10th percentile (entry level) to $141,070 at the 90th percentile (experienced). The middle 50% earn between $61,490 and $117,330.

Data Source & Methodology

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2025 estimates. The OEWS survey covers approximately 1.1 million establishments nationwide.

Annual salaries are calculated based on a standard 2,080-hour work year. Actual compensation may vary based on experience, education, employer, and local market conditions. Figures do not include benefits, bonuses, or overtime pay.
